Output 379253c19a7a226acf82ffddd0152df4a1c377abac3af4b8916a2a42dffc2f79:2

value
516972504
script pubkey
OP_0 OP_PUSHBYTES_32 064aef451b501781f16a0c2005922b6cc11cac9dccda003b9b212429f00cab66
address
bc1qqe9w73gm2qtcrut2pssqty3tdnq3etyaendqqwumyyjznuqv4dnqev2hvf
transaction
379253c19a7a226acf82ffddd0152df4a1c377abac3af4b8916a2a42dffc2f79
spent
true